Text of Freedom Document
Know all men by these presents that I John Chew, Executor of Robert Chew dec’d, for and in consideration of the services heretofore done and performed by Janey, alias James Gordon, do by these presents emancipate and set free the said Janey (James Gordon) and I do hereby absolve and discharge the said Janey alias James Gordon from all rights or further services which I may ever heretofore have been entitled to from him. In witness whereof I have hereunto set my hand and seal this 30th day of May 1790.
Jn. Chew (seal)
At a court continued and held for Spotsylvania County on Wednesday the 8th day of June 1790.
This writing from under the hand and seal of John Chew, Executor of Robert Chew Gent dec’d, for the emancipation of January alias James Gordon was acknowledged by the said John Chew and ordered to be recorded.
Ex’d & Del’d Ja’s Gordon Teste, J Chew C.S.G.
